Abstract :
With the development of industrialization and informationization, especially with the rising of Internet of Things, wireless sensor network (WSN) has being used in more and more fields. In this paper, a manufacturing Sensor Network Based on Multi-Radio and Multi-Channel (MR-MC) has been proposed. Firstly, the characteristics of the manufacturing network has been analyzed, and then state the new proposed wireless manufacturing sensor network in detail from three aspects: network architecture, topology structure and key problems, finally, in order to evaluate the validity of the proposed network, an experimental model based on OPNET has been developed and a set of experiments has been carried out.
